Output f63066a15dad211907bf425c9843de1dc5da6506262ba66fa54e359ddbb029da:1

value
45072124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f17a15d5a64a3197a825ac2bdfe6516093f0457 OP_EQUAL
address
34XRBMXKhGeaHF3b4sKgS7jsrap4nqgSE1
transaction
f63066a15dad211907bf425c9843de1dc5da6506262ba66fa54e359ddbb029da
spent
true